Data Science Interview Preparation
Data Science interviews usually focus on analytical thinking, statistics, Python basics, and problem-solving.
Common Questions
- What is Data Science?
- Difference between supervised and unsupervised learning?
- What is data cleaning?
- Explain regression and classification.
- Which Python libraries are used in Data Science?
Preparation Tips
- Practice Python basics and Pandas.
- Learn data visualization tools.
- Work on mini-projects using datasets.
- Understand real-world business problems.
Recruiters often prefer candidates who can explain projects clearly rather than simply memorizing definitions.

Oracle DBA Interview Preparation
Oracle DBA roles focus on database administration, backup management, security, and troubleshooting.
Common Questions
- What is Oracle Database?
- What are the responsibilities of an Oracle DBA?
- Explain backup and recovery.
- What is RMAN?
- Difference between SQL and PL/SQL?
Preparation Tips
- Practice database creation and SQL queries.
- Learn backup concepts practically.
- Understand database security basics.
- Prepare for troubleshooting scenarios.
Hands-on practice is extremely important for Oracle DBA interviews.
Oracle Developer Interview Preparation
Oracle developer interviews test SQL, PL/SQL, database concepts, and query optimization.
Common Questions
- What are joins in SQL?
- Explain stored procedures.
- What is a trigger?
- Difference between DELETE and TRUNCATE?
- What is normalization?
Preparation Tips
- Practice SQL queries daily.
- Work on database mini-projects.
- Learn PL/SQL programming basics.
- Focus on query optimization concepts.
Strong database fundamentals help candidates perform confidently.

Java Interview Preparation
Java interviews test programming logic, object-oriented programming, and problem-solving skills.
Common Questions
- What is Java?
- Explain OOP concepts.
- Difference between JDK, JRE, and JVM?
- What is inheritance?
- What is Spring Boot?
Preparation Tips
- Practice coding daily.
- Focus on Core Java concepts.
- Learn basic SQL and backend logic.
- Build mini-projects for practice.
Strong logical thinking and coding confidence are very important for Java interviews.
Common HR Questions for Freshers
Along with technical questions, most companies also ask HR questions.
Frequently Asked HR Questions
- Tell me about yourself.
- Why should we hire you?
- What are your strengths and weaknesses?
- Where do you see yourself in five years?
- Why do you want this role?
Best Preparation Strategy
- Speak confidently.
- Avoid memorized robotic answers.
- Give practical examples.
- Keep answers clear and professional.
Communication and confidence often create strong first impressions.
